Position within the UK market structure

Oxford Instruments occupies a distinctive position within the UK equity landscape, particularly among companies focused on precision engineering and scientific capability. The organisation’s activities span materials analysis, nanotechnology, and advanced imaging, all of which play a crucial role in academic research, semiconductor development, and industrial manufacturing. These areas have continued to receive attention across global markets as technological capability becomes increasingly integral to economic competitiveness.

Index environment and broader context

The FTSE 350 represents a wide cross-section of UK-listed companies, combining constituents from both the FTSE one hundred and FTSE two hundred and fifty segments. This index serves as a key reference point for assessing overall market conditions, reflecting movements across sectors and providing insight into the direction of UK equities.

Movements within this index often mirror shifts in economic sentiment, global trade conditions, and sector-specific developments. Operational focus and technological relevance

Oxford Instruments continues to focus on delivering high-precision tools that enable scientific exploration and industrial efficiency. Its product range includes systems designed for analysing materials at atomic and molecular levels, as well as solutions tailored for semiconductor fabrication and quality assurance. These capabilities are increasingly relevant as industries pursue advancements in miniaturisation, energy efficiency, and performance optimisation.
